Hey Tarheel, Welcome.

The USB Passthrough basicly replaces the battery by allowing you to plug into a USB outlet. (Not all of them will work.) It's great for saving your conserving your batteries, and using near a desktop computer or gaming system.

I cant say for sure if every 901 atomizer will work with the Pure Smoker Pass. I'm positive the EM-901 atty wont work with it.

The Puresmoker Passthrough rocks. I'm at work using it right now and I have nothing but good things to say about it. Totally worth the price/wait.

The PSPT=Pure Smoker USB Pass Thru. It replaces the battery on your e-cig to provide an alternative power source. Unlike most commercial ecig batteries, this provides a constant and consistent 5V power source (vs. 3.7V), and not to be compared with many of the PT (Passthrough/Passthru) that are manufactured out of China (easily broken/unreliable), these were designed and made in the USA, using quality parts through and through.

Keep in mind you'll need to be at a usb power source when using a PT. You can go portable via a laptop or external power pack (basically a usb battery pack), however this depends on your definition of "portability".

The PSPT is not designed to work in any way with the Prodigy (unless you count using the same atomizers), however its adapters will fit the upcoming Protege.
